FDP Seeks to Scrap Religious Education in Mecklenburg-Vorpommern

ZEIT Online

The Free Democratic Party (FDP) in Mecklenburg-Vorpommern has dramatically shifted its stance on education, announcing its withdrawal from supporting the traditional Haupt- und Realschule system. This controversial decision, driven by disagreements over educational policy and a push for comprehensive schools, is already generating significant debate across Germany.

The FDP’s move is primarily fueled by their campaign to eliminate religious instruction in schools, a position reflecting a core tenet of their party’s ideology regarding the separation of church and state. This stance has ignited considerable controversy, particularly within local religious communities who rely on school-based religious education. The state government of Mecklenburg-Vorpommern is now facing a critical juncture, needing to navigate the FDP’s demands while simultaneously addressing concerns about educational diversity and the potential impact on students’ access to faith-based learning. Experts predict this decision will likely trigger a wider national conversation about the role of religion in public education and the future of school choice options within the German education system.
